Yosef

Yosef (also transliterated as Yossef, Josef, Yoseph Tiberian Hebrew and Aramaic Yôsēp̄) is a male Hebrew name יוֹסֵף , from Hebrew יה-וה להוסיף YHWH Lhosif meaning "YHWH will increase/add". It is the Hebrew equivalent of the English name Joseph, and the Arabic name Yusuf.
